About University of Poitiers:

The University of Poitiers currently serves more than 23,000 students and employs more than 3,000 people: Teachers and Academics / Librarians, engineers, technicians, workmen, administrative, service and health workers / Temporary teaching and research staff / Language assistants / Contract PhD students / and Contract teachers. The international dimension is one of the major priorities of the University of Poitiers. This is materialized each year by the reception of about 4,000 students from 136 different countries. With 17% foreign students, the University of Poitiers is above the national average. The reasons for this success lie in its wide and diversified range of programs, but also in the human size of our University, allowing for personalized student follow-up and a relaxed yet culturally rich experience. One of the main strengths of Poitiers University is its comprehensiveness and multi-disciplinary offerings, for the benefit of all students. With over 200 national diplomas available in all fields of study, Poitiers University offers diversified training programmes, which are regularly adapted to meet evolving professional requirements.
